Julia Newton 1535–1597 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1535

Birth Location: Steventon, Shropshire, England

Death Date: 1597

Death Location: Steventon, Berkshire, England

Father: Sir Newton

Mother: Johane Kyffyn

Spouse(s): Robert Daniell, Richard George

Children(s): Lady Daniel, Agnes Daniell, John Daniell, Richard Daniel

In 1535, Julia Newton entered the world in Steventon, Shropshire, England, born to Sir Peter Newton And Johane Agnes Kyffyn. Julia Newton married Richard Westbury George, Robert Daniell, and had children including Agnes Daniell, John Daniell, Lady Mary Ann Daniel, Richard Daniel. Julia Newton passed away in 1597 in Steventon, Berkshire, England.
